macOS
-
Using the Character Viewer:
- Open System Preferences and select "Keyboard".
- Check the box that says "Show Keyboard & Emoji viewers in menu bar".
- Click on the input menu (usually a flag or language icon) in the menu bar, then select "Show Emoji & Symbols".
- In the Character Viewer window, you can search for "dog" to find relevant symbols.
- Double-click the symbol to insert it into your document.
